| Description: | Our Gene-specific Break Apart Probes usually target the flanks of the target gene (WRN). Due to this design method, our probe products can detect chromosomal rearrangements, such as translocations, by FISH.The product usually consists of a reagent combination composed of a probe with a selected dye color and a hybridization reagent. |
| Application: | WRN Gene-specific Break Apart Probe is designed to detect potential WRN rearrangements. This probe has been confirmed on the metaphase and interphase chromosomes by FISH. | Gene Name | Werner Syndrome RecQ Like Helicase |
| Gene Summary [Provided by RefSeq] | This gene encodes a member of the RecQ subfamily of DNA helicase proteins. The encoded nuclear protein is important in the maintenance of genome stability and plays a role in DNA repair, replication, transcription and telomere maintenance. This protein contains a N-terminal 3' to 5' exonuclease domain, an ATP-dependent helicase domain and RQC (RecQ helicase conserved region) domain in its central region, and a C-terminal HRDC (helicase RNase D C-terminal) domain and nuclear localization signal. Defects in this gene are the cause of Werner syndrome, an autosomal recessive disorder characterized by accelerated aging and an elevated risk for certain cancers. [provided by RefSeq, Aug 2017] |
